One: The merits of whiteness

How strong is the white? Why it is called the first of the four famous generals of the Warring States, we can see at a glance a list of achievements.

In the Battle of Yique, Bai Qi pressed 240,000 han, Wei, and Eastern Zhou allies to the ground and rubbed them, almost completely annihilating the enemy.

In the Battle of Yanyin, Bai Qi pressed hundreds of thousands of Chu troops to the ground and rubbed them, causing the Chu state to move its capital.

In the Battle of Huayang, Bai Qi pressed 150,000 Wei and Zhao troops to the ground and rubbed them, almost completely annihilating the enemy.

At the Battle of Hingseong, Bai Qi pressed 50,000 South Korean troops to the ground and rubbed them, making South Korea the first country to be destroyed.

In the Battle of Changping, Bai Qi pressed 450,000 Zhao Guo to the ground and rubbed it, and 450,000 troops were killed by Bai Qi.

This record is rare in ancient and modern times, and it is simply the record of the God of War. In addition, Bai Qi was undefeated in his life, serving as a general in the Qin State for more than 30 years, and made such a great contribution to Great Qin. Two: the reason for killing Bai Qi

First of all, we must rule out the statement of the Gong Gao Zhen Lord. Although Bai Qi's merit was particularly high, it did not reach the point where it was a threat to King Zhaoxiang of Qin. This is related to the system of the Qin state, the heir of the Qin state can only be a royal family, if Bai Qi wants to become an emperor, the qin clan and his ministers will stop it. In addition, Bai Qi was a general, and his duties were military, and in terms of politics, he could hardly play King Zhaoxiang of Qin.

So the reasons why Bai Qi was killed I think there are the following.

1. Bai Qi did not give face to King Zhaoxiang of Qin, and King Zhaoxiang of Qin remembered the hatred in his heart. After the Battle of Changping, King Zhaoxiang of Qin wanted to destroy the State of Zhao. At first, Bai Qi was willing to do it, but King Zhaoxiang of Qin did not agree, he felt that he still had to let the army of the State of Qin rest, and later after Xin Lingjun took the Wei army to aid the State of Zhao, Bai Qi felt that the timing was not right and could not be done. And King Zhaoxiang of Qin urged Bai to go and work, feeling that the Qin army had rested well. Bai began to be sick and never moved. Later, King Zhaoxiang of Qin sent other generals to fight, and as a result, he was pressed to the ground by Xin Lingjun and rubbed, and after the defeat of the Qin army, Bai Qi said some cool words, which made King Zhaoxiang of Qin hate him.

2. Fan Ju pushed the waves, although Fan Ju is also a famous appearance, but he is still too stingy for the matter of Bai Qi. He and Bai Qi are contradictory, after all, Bai Qi is so good, it is inevitable that there will be jealousy. So Fan Ju made a rumor to King Zhaoxiang of Qin, hoping to give death to Bai Qi!

3. All six nations want to die in vain. Bai Qi was a human slaughter, and the most killed were the armies of the four kingdoms of Han Zhao, Wei and Chu. For Yan Qi, although he had not fought with Bai Qi, it was obvious that he knew how powerful Bai Qi was. Therefore, the people of the Six Kingdoms all wanted to die in vain, and they constantly sent spies or lessons to the rulers of the Qin State to blow some white threat theories.
